Another Tuesday, another Upside Down Dog of the Week from Upsidedowndogs.com. This week’s winner is Monkey, a 9-year-old male Labrador Retriever and Collie mix from Wellington, New Zealand. Here’s what his owner Alex has to say about him:

“For reasons completely unknown to him, he can’t sleep in any position except upside-down with his legs sticking out at random angles. And when he turns over, his eyes go green. Right-Way-Up, they’re brown. Go figure. We think the earthquakes in Wellington earlier this year may have broken him…

Way to go Monkey! Tune in next week for another hilarious Upside Down Dog of the Week.
